Things to do near Northern Quarter

Shopping

In the Northern Quarter, you’ll discover an array of independent boutiques and vintage shops, such as Afflecks, known for its eclectic offerings. The vibrant atmosphere is complemented by the Manchester Craft and Design Centre, showcasing unique handmade gifts and souvenirs that reflect the local culture.

Recreation

Experience the tranquility at The Spa at The Midland, where you can indulge in rejuvenating treatments and unwind in the serene relaxation area. For a unique experience, visit the Northern Quarter's yoga studios, offering various classes that promote mindfulness and well-being amidst the vibrant artsy atmosphere.

Adventure

At Oulton Park Circuit, 42km from the Northern Quarter, experience the thrill of motor racing amidst a vibrant atmosphere. Feel the adrenaline as you watch high-speed races or participate in driving experiences that cater to motorsport enthusiasts seeking excitement and adventure.

Nightlife

Explore the vibrant nightlife at The Castle Hotel on Oldham Street, where you can enjoy live music in a lively atmosphere. For a unique cocktail experience, visit The Rum Bar on Edge Street, offering an extensive selection of rums in a relaxed setting.

Best time to go to Northern Quarter

The best time to visit Northern Quarter is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January39.0°F (3.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February39.9°F (4.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
March42.6°F (5.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
April46.9°F (8.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
May52.2°F (11.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June57.7°F (14.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ly High
July60.6°F (15.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
August60.1°F (15.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
September56.5°F (13.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
October51.3°F (10.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
November45.0°F (7.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
December40.8°F (4.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age

What is there to do in this Manchester neighbourhood?
If you're looking forward to a day of shopping in Northern Quarter, consider Affleck's Palace or Market Street, and pick out the perfect souvenir. As you're discovering the neighbourhood, Greater Manchester Police Museum and Manchester Buddhist Centre are some other places worth a visit. A few places to visit in the area around Northern Quarter include Old Trafford, Chinese Arts Centre and Cutting Room Square. While you're out sightseeing, Manchester Arndale and Printworks are a couple of additional sights to visit in Manchester.
